How to Redeem the Codes

  1. Join the Anime Final Quest Roblox group first — codes won’t redeem without this step.
  2. Launch Anime Final Quest and let the game load in.
  3. Press the Codes button on the right side of the screen.
  4. Type or paste a working code into the “Enter Codes Here” text box.
  5. Hit Confirm to claim your reward.

Keep in mind that some codes may only redeem inside a private server rather than a public one, so if a valid code isn’t working, try switching servers before assuming it’s expired. Typos are the other common culprit — copying and pasting directly from the list above avoids that issue entirely.
